Java是一种编程语言,而Java开发工具包(JDK)和Java运行时环境(JRE)则是Java平台的基本部分。
JDK是Java应用程序开发的基本组件,它包含了Java编程语言的开发工具和Java类库。在JDK中,最重要的部分是Javac编译器和Java虚拟机。你可以使用Javac编译器将Java源代码编译成Java字节码,然后使用Java虚拟机运行这些字节码。此外,JDK还包括了其他工具,如Javadoc文档生成器、Java调试器、性能工具等。
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ello World!");
}
}
在上面的代码中,我们使用Javac编译器将Java源代码编译成字节码,然后使用Java虚拟机来运行它。
JRE是Java应用程序的运行环境,它包含了运行Java程序所需的Java虚拟机和Java类库。如果你只是想运行Java应用程序而不需要开发新的应用程序,那么你只需要安装JRE即可。
总的来说,JDK和JRE是Java平台的核心部分,它们为Java应用程序的开发和运行提供了必要的基础设施。